Abstract(in English) | The high power semiconductor lasers tend to show unstable lasing mode oscillation and tend to be suffer from the optical feedback. The lasers are required to suppress the noise especially low frequency region very close to DC. We report here the noise reduction in the frequency range from DC to several MHz with 80mW light output in semiconductor lasers. Sufficient noise reduction more than 25dB was achieved with 80mW output. |
